Tokenized Stocks Now Have Nearly 3 Million Holders, But Trading Volume Halved

Source Beincrypto

Holders of distributed tokenized assets reached an all-time high of 3.67 million, according to real-world asset tracker RWA.xyz.

Tokenized stocks did nearly all the lifting. They account for 80.58% of distributed asset holders, leaving every rival category far behind.

Stocks Dwarf Every Other Tokenized Asset Class

Stocks accounted for 2.96 million of the total. Commodities ranked a distant second, at roughly 332,000, followed by asset-backed credit at roughly 91,000 and active strategies at roughly 81,000.

US Treasury debt counted close to 73,000 holders despite anchoring the sector by value. Real estate held about 15,000, and venture capital fewer than 1,500.

The gap reflects how fast equity tokenization has scaled since platforms started bringing blue-chip listings onchain. Tokenized stocks alone now span 5,246 individual assets worth $2.89 billion, a 14.03% gain in 30 days. 

Overall, the represented asset value across all tokenized assets reached $386.92 billion, up 3.63% over the past month. Distributed value grew far more slowly, rising 1.54% to $39.15 billion.

A Wider Base, Thinner Trading

The holder boom sits beside the slower activity data. Tokenized stockholders grew 159.31% in 30 days, yet monthly transfer volume fell 50.96% to $13.14 billion.

Monthly active addresses dropped 48.36% to 760,339 over the same stretch. More people now hold these tokens. Fewer appear willing to trade them.

That chill has spread to decentralized venues, too. Real-world asset perpetual volume fell 13.5% to $122 billion in August, down from a record $141 billion in July.

Ondo leads platforms by value at $860 million, ahead of xStocks at $631.2 million and bStocks at $627.5 million. Robinhood holds $133.2 million across 189 assets, as its chief executive pushes for US access to tokenized equities.

Whether that widening base converts back into volume is the question the coming weeks should settle.
